I'm Revisiting my laptimer setup with spring now here and more iPhone 5 options available than when I last looked into it over the winter.

I see many of the recommended options use bluetooth and seem to work together, if my research is correct. My question-- if I go with this popular combination (DualXGPS + GoPointBT1 + Ram Mount and iPhone 5 case (RAM-HOL-AP11U)) how are you folks charging your phone while laptimer is running?

I would have liked to have the GPS or OBD connected to the phone and charging, but it looks like the old cabled GoPoint isn't available anymore. Figured someone must have this figured another charging option as I record video and it eats the battery pretty quickly. Any ideas welcome.

Both the Dual and the BT1 are Bluetooth devices so the iPhone has a free dock and can be charged...or am I missing something? BT1 does not need charging and the Dual doesn't run out of battery that quick and you are still able to go for a dual 12V plug in the car and load both iPhone and Dual while lapping.
